What you will be doing

  • Design and continuously refine an AI-powered learning ecosystem that delivers measurable advantages over traditional education, demonstrated through concrete student achievement metrics
  • Connect directly with students via digital platforms to gather firsthand insights about their learning journeys, challenges, and victories—using these perspectives to drive ecosystem enhancements
  • Extract actionable intelligence from platform data to develop high-impact interventions leveraging artificial intelligence, learning science research, and motivational psychology
  • Foster a culture where bold experimentation and data-driven decisions thrive, using analytics to catalyze breakthrough improvements in student growth trajectories
  • Collaborate with engineering, data science, and design specialists to transform academic insights and student feedback into seamless product improvements

Key responsibilities

Drive breakthrough innovation in teacher-less, AI-powered education to produce exceptional student outcomes across multiple campus locations. Combine sophisticated data analytics with regular student interaction to continuously optimize our learning ecosystem, with success measured concretely through AP exam performance and MAP assessment growth metrics.

Candidate requirements

  • Advanced degree (Master's or higher) in Educational Science, Learning Science, Psychology, Psychometrics, Instructional Design, or related discipline
  • Demonstrated leadership experience within education or educational technology sectors
  • Practical experience implementing AI technologies in educational or professional settings
  • Hands-on experience designing and deploying AI systems for educational applications such as content generation, data analysis, or adaptive learning
  • Comprehensive understanding of learning science foundations and evidence-based educational methodologies
  • Exceptional ability to translate complex educational and technical concepts for diverse stakeholders
  • Proven track record managing cross-functional teams and orchestrating complex project initiatives
